WebThe act of eating and drinking with Jesus has been called by a number of names: Holy Communion, the Lord’s Supper, the Eucharist, the Breaking of Bread. Each of these points to a particular meaning. The titles “Breaking of Bread” and “the Lord’s Supper” emphasize the oldest New Testament accounts of the institution of the sacrament ...

WebWhen the minister gives us Eucharist (communion) at Mass, he or she says: Body of Christ. We say: Amen. Our Amen means YES. YES, we believe and YES we will. This has two meanings: We believe that the bread and wine becomes the love of Jesus made real.
